Scope and Contents

File contains four copies of the 1997-98 Rome Prize Winner announcement booklets. The Winners include: Daniel Castor, Architecture; Catherine Seavitt, Architecture; Paul Davis, Design Arts; Mark Schimmenti, Design Arts; Shelley Fletcher, Historic Preservation and Conservation; Frederick Steiner, Historic Preservation and Conservation; Elise Brewster, Landscape Architecture; Mary Margaret Jones, Landscape Architecture; P.Q.Phan, Musical Composition; Andrew Rindfleisch, Musical Composition; Douglas Argue, Visual Arts; Charles Ledray, Visual Arts; Agnes Denes, Visual Arts; Fae Myenne Ng, Literature; Sheila Dillon, Classical Studies and Archaeology; Myles McDonnell, Classical Studies and Archaeology; Jennifer Trimble, Classical Studies and Archaeology; Shane Butler, Classical Studies and Archaeology; Tod Marder, History of Art; David Stone, History of Art; Jonathan Marciari, History of Art; Alison Frazier, Post-Classical Humanistic Studies; Maria Fuller, Post-Classical Humanistic Studies; Laura Wittman, Post-Classical Humanistic Studies.
